摘要:

AbstractInvestigation into the rnechanism(s) whereby monocytes‐macrophages are mobilized to the myocardium of coxsackievirus (CVB3)‐infected mice was approached by assessing the role of anti‐idiotypic antibodies against specific antiviral IgG molecules. Balb/c mice preinocuiated with polyclonal anti‐idiotypic, syngeneic antibodies resulted in significantly decreased myocarditis after virus challenge. On the other hand, oil‐induced peritoneal exudate cells obtained from virus‐exposed animals demonstrated increased chemotaxis in the presence of polyclonal anti‐Id preparations, whereas peritoneal exudate cells from normal animals did not Specificity of the anti‐Ids as confirmed by the binding of the syngeneic anti‐anti‐idiotypic antibodies (antibody 3) to solubilized viral antigen(s) and Fab fragments prepared from the anti‐idiotypic antibodies. Paradoxic biological effects of anti‐Id, demonstrated in vitro and in vivo, suggest possible and subtle immunoregulatton of the macrophage effector arm by anti‐ldiotypes during the course of virus infection.
